Output 520905600df30d6a93dc472aa907121cd963376f52327b53b1d6ecb35c73c78a:1
- value
- 781250000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4c3580ab0b0d8d5d3866d71f7e73ddd882c8244 OP_EQUALVERIFY OP_CHECKSIG
- address
- DMctBXAiBzAWpj7de92Jj4XbFvzbwhqTPU
- transaction
- 520905600df30d6a93dc472aa907121cd963376f52327b53b1d6ecb35c73c78a